This will depend on the situation of the match up to that point often. However I think you should play each point focusing on the tactics that are winning you points. If the score is 9 all your opponent still doesn't want to receive that serve that has been troubling them for the whole game. Play each point with the best tactics you have.
A chopper likes to get back from the table and get into a nice rhythm. If you keep the defender close to the table in the early part of the rally, it's hard for them to transition back into their chopping position.
